College hoops sides & totals - no play if it's moved more than 1/2 point.
NBA - no play if it's moved 1.5 or more. At a point yes, as I figure I get enough movement both ways (win some, lose some).

Football - I don't worry about a point unless it's crossing key #'s (2'-3', 3-4, 6'-7', 9'-10'). If it was 3, goes to 3.5, I'll buy it back down to 3 but not gonna buy a 4 back down to 2.5.
